## Authorization

The StageGrid renderer exposes two endpoints: `/seatmap/render` and `/seatmap/layout`. Both require a bearer token scoped to a single venue; cross-venue requests are rejected with 403. Tokens are signed, carry a 15-minute TTL, and cannot be refreshed — clients must re-mint. No endpoint accepts query-string credentials. Rate limiting is per-token, 120 requests per minute. Audit logs record token fingerprints, never raw values. For the review sandbox covering the fictional Marrow Hall venue, use the token below.

login token, hahif-bajog: eyJhbGciOiJIUzI1NiIsInR5cCI6IkpXVCJ9.eyJzdWIiOiIHJXUrbIn0.JC-NFEAJ

Subject: Waveform preview cut-over complete

Team,

The audio waveform preview service moved from Tonecrest's legacy renderer to the new Rippleline pipeline last night. Old endpoints are dark. Previews now generate at upload rather than on first play, so cold-start lag is gone. New joiners: Rippleline owns peak extraction, caching, and the SVG render path. If a preview looks flat, check the extractor queue before filing anything. Marisol handles escalations this sprint. The values below are what Rippleline currently runs with in production.

settings of fafog-haduf:
ZORIX_PIN=4648
ZORIX_METRICS_HOST=metrics.zorix.paliqsys.corp
ZORIX_LOG_LEVEL=info
ZORIX_TENANT=druix

### Action Item 3: Harden the Ostrell partner SFTP drop

Root cause: partial uploads picked up mid-transfer, producing truncated feeds. Fix: require sentinel files, enforce a minimum file age before ingest, and quarantine anything failing checksum. Reviewer: confirm the poller respects all three gates and logs quarantined drops. Agreed thresholds are below.

tuning table, kajog-bawip:
TIERS = {
    "kelius": 256,
    "lammir": 543,
}

Hey Marisol — handing over the flaky DNS thing on Cinderquay before I'm out. Short version: the resolver in the Brightmoor pods intermittently times out on internal lookups, looks like stale entries in the sidecar cache. Bumped the cache TTL down and added retry jitter; incidents dropped but not gone. Dario has context too. The resolver settings I landed on are below.

service settings:
HOLMIR_PIN=4823
HOLMIR_METRICS_HOST=metrics.holmir.nelvroworks.internal
HOLMIR_LOG_LEVEL=info
HOLMIR_TENANT=istael